Vanguard Mega Cap ETF (NYSEARCA:MGC) Sees Significant Drop in Short Interest

Vanguard Mega Cap ETF (NYSEARCA:MGCG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large drop in short interest in the month of August. As of August 31st, there was short interest totaling 13,051 shares, a drop of 65.1% from the August 15th total of 37,392 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 65,980 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.2 days. Approximately 0.0% of the company’s stock are short sold.

Vanguard Mega Cap ETF Price Performance

Shares of Vanguard Mega Cap ETF stock opened at $281.25 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$10.29 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 26.06 and a beta of 1.02. The stock’s 50-day moving average is $278.09 and its 200-day moving average is $265.89. Vanguard Mega Cap ETF has a one year low of $228.37 and a one year high of $285.55.

Vanguard Mega Cap ETF Company Profile

The Vanguard Mega Cap ETF (MGC)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the CRSP US Mega Cap index, a market-cap-weighted index that covers 70% of the market capitalization of the US equity market. MGC was launched on Dec 24, 2007 and is managed by Vanguard.
